If you are in NYC most companies over 100 employees have to provide coverage for “up to 3 ivf cycles” which has helped move the needle on companies who provide coverage the last couple of years.

Progressive has ivf coverage. 3 retreivals is where it maxes at unless all 3 are unsuccessful in securing any eggs, in which case you can appeal for a 4th. Also covers 6 iui
6 iui is in addition. It's actually 6 iui or 6 medicated, but you might as well do them iui at that point. That was what the winfertility specialist advised. Unlimited implantations IF the eggs come from those 3 allowed retreivals. Once you use up those eggs, you're done. There are medication limits, injectibles have to go through freedom and everything else has to go through cvs specialty pharmacy.
